关于VB的几道编程题 谢谢帮忙·
1-4:在名称为Form1的窗体上建立二个名称分别为Cmd1、Cmd2,标题为“按钮一”、“按钮二”的命令按钮(如图1所示)。要求程序运行后,如果单击“按钮一”,则把“按...
1-4:在名称为Form1的窗体上建立二个名称分别为Cmd1、Cmd2,标题为“按钮一”、“按钮二”的命令按钮(如图1所示)。要求程序运行后,如果单击“按钮一”,则把“按钮二”移到“按钮一”上(如图2所示),使两个按钮重合。
1-5:在名称为Form1的窗体上画一个命令按钮,名称为Command1,其标题为“移动本按钮”,如图所示。要求编写适当的事件过程,使得程序运行是,每单击按钮一次,按钮向左移动100。要求:程序中不得使用变量,事件过程中只能写一条语句。
在名称为Form1的窗体上画一个名称为L1的标签,标题为“请确认”;再画两个命令按钮,名称分别为C1、C2,标题分别为“是”、“否”,高均为300,宽均为800。如图所示。
请在属性窗口中设置适当属性满足以下要求:
1) 窗体标题为“确认”,窗体标题栏上不显示最大化和最小化按钮;
2) 在任何情况下,按回车键都相当于单击“是”按钮;按ESC键都相当于单击“否”按钮。
1-7:在名称为Form1的窗体上画一个名称为Lab的标签,设置高度为450,宽度为1500,标签上显示内容为“标签”。要求程序运行后,若双击窗体则执行语句Lab.Caption=“双击”,若单击窗体则执行语句Lab.Caption=“”。
1-8:在名称为Form1的窗体上画两个标签(名称分别为Label1和Label2,标题分别为“书名”和“作者”)、两个文本框(名称分别为Text1和Text2,Text属性均为空白)和一个命令按钮(名称为Command1,标题为“显示”),如图1所示。然后编写命令按钮的Click事件过程。程序运行后,在两个文本框中分别输入书名和作者,然后单击命令按钮,则在窗体的标题栏上先后显示两个文本框中的内容,如图2所示。要求程序中不得使用任何变量。
1-9:在名称为Form1的窗体上画一个标签(名称为Label1,标题为“输入信息”)、一个文本框(名称为Text1,Text属性为空白)和一个命令按钮(名称为Command1,标题为“显示”),如图1所示。然后编写命令按钮的Click事件过程。程序运行后,在文本框中输入“计算机等级考试”,然后单击命令按钮,则标签和文本框消失,并在窗体上显示文本框中的内容。运行后的窗体如图2所示。要求程序中不得使用任何变量。
1-10:在名称为Form1的窗体上画一个名称为L1的标签,标题为“口令”;画两个文本框,名称分别为Text1、Text2,都没有
初始内容;再画三个命令按钮,名称分别为C1、C2、C3,标题分别为“显示口令”、“隐藏口令”、“复制口令”。在开始运行时,向Text1中输入的所有字符,都显示“*”,单击“显示口令”按钮后,在Text1中显示所有字符,再单击“以隐藏口令”后,Text1中的字符不变,但显示的都是“?”,单击“复制口令”后,把Text1中的实际内容复制到Text2中,如图所示。
要求:
1) 在属性窗口中,把窗体的标题改为“口令窗口”;
2) 建立适当的事件过程,完成上述功能。每个过程中只允许写一条语句,且不能使用变量。
麻烦大家把过程写一下·· 展开
1-5:在名称为Form1的窗体上画一个命令按钮,名称为Command1,其标题为“移动本按钮”,如图所示。要求编写适当的事件过程,使得程序运行是,每单击按钮一次,按钮向左移动100。要求:程序中不得使用变量,事件过程中只能写一条语句。
在名称为Form1的窗体上画一个名称为L1的标签,标题为“请确认”;再画两个命令按钮,名称分别为C1、C2,标题分别为“是”、“否”,高均为300,宽均为800。如图所示。
请在属性窗口中设置适当属性满足以下要求:
1) 窗体标题为“确认”,窗体标题栏上不显示最大化和最小化按钮;
2) 在任何情况下,按回车键都相当于单击“是”按钮;按ESC键都相当于单击“否”按钮。
1-7:在名称为Form1的窗体上画一个名称为Lab的标签,设置高度为450,宽度为1500,标签上显示内容为“标签”。要求程序运行后,若双击窗体则执行语句Lab.Caption=“双击”,若单击窗体则执行语句Lab.Caption=“”。
1-8:在名称为Form1的窗体上画两个标签(名称分别为Label1和Label2,标题分别为“书名”和“作者”)、两个文本框(名称分别为Text1和Text2,Text属性均为空白)和一个命令按钮(名称为Command1,标题为“显示”),如图1所示。然后编写命令按钮的Click事件过程。程序运行后,在两个文本框中分别输入书名和作者,然后单击命令按钮,则在窗体的标题栏上先后显示两个文本框中的内容,如图2所示。要求程序中不得使用任何变量。
1-9:在名称为Form1的窗体上画一个标签(名称为Label1,标题为“输入信息”)、一个文本框(名称为Text1,Text属性为空白)和一个命令按钮(名称为Command1,标题为“显示”),如图1所示。然后编写命令按钮的Click事件过程。程序运行后,在文本框中输入“计算机等级考试”,然后单击命令按钮,则标签和文本框消失,并在窗体上显示文本框中的内容。运行后的窗体如图2所示。要求程序中不得使用任何变量。
1-10:在名称为Form1的窗体上画一个名称为L1的标签,标题为“口令”;画两个文本框,名称分别为Text1、Text2,都没有
初始内容;再画三个命令按钮,名称分别为C1、C2、C3,标题分别为“显示口令”、“隐藏口令”、“复制口令”。在开始运行时,向Text1中输入的所有字符,都显示“*”,单击“显示口令”按钮后,在Text1中显示所有字符,再单击“以隐藏口令”后,Text1中的字符不变,但显示的都是“?”,单击“复制口令”后,把Text1中的实际内容复制到Text2中,如图所示。
要求:
1) 在属性窗口中,把窗体的标题改为“口令窗口”;
2) 建立适当的事件过程,完成上述功能。每个过程中只允许写一条语句,且不能使用变量。
麻烦大家把过程写一下·· 展开
3个回答
展开全部
1-4:在名称为Form1的窗体上建立二个名称分别为Cmd1、Cmd2,标题为“按钮一”、“按钮二”的命令按钮(如图1所示)。要求程序运行后,如果单击“按钮一”,则把“按钮二”移到“按钮一”上(如图2所示),使两个按钮重合。
private sub cmd1_click()
cmd2.move cmd1.left,cmd1.top,cmd1.width,cmd1.height
end sub
1-5:在名称为Form1的窗体上画一个命令按钮,名称为Command1,其标题为“移动本按钮”,如图所示。要求编写适当的事件过程,使得程序运行是,每单击按钮一次,按钮向左移动100。要求:程序中不得使用变量,事件过程中只能写一条语句。
private sub command1_click()
command1.left = command1.left - 100
end sub
在名称为Form1的窗体上画一个名称为L1的标签,标题为“请确认”;再画两个命令按钮,名称分别为C1、C2,标题分别为“是”、“否”,高均为300,宽均为800。如图所示。
请在属性窗口中设置适当属性满足以下要求:
1) 窗体标题为“确认”,窗体标题栏上不显示最大化和最小化按钮;
2) 在任何情况下,按回车键都相当于单击“是”按钮;按ESC键都相当于单击“否”按钮。
1)点击窗体,属性里面设置Caption为确认,设置MaxButton=False,MinButton=False
2)点击“是”按钮(c1),设置Default=true
点击“否”按钮(c2),设置cancel=true
1-7:在名称为Form1的窗体上画一个名称为Lab的标签,设置高度为450,宽度为1500,标签上显示内容为“标签”。要求程序运行后,若双击窗体则执行语句Lab.Caption=“双击”,若单击窗体则执行语句Lab.Caption=“”。
private sub form_click()
lab.caption = ""
end sub
private sub form_dblclick()
lab.caption = "双击"
end sub
1-8:在名称为Form1的窗体上画两个标签(名称分别为Label1和Label2,标题分别为“书名”和“作者”)、两个文本框(名称分别为Text1和Text2,Text属性均为空白)和一个命令按钮(名称为Command1,标题为“显示”),如图1所示。然后编写命令按钮的Click事件过程。程序运行后,在两个文本框中分别输入书名和作者,然后单击命令按钮,则在窗体的标题栏上先后显示两个文本框中的内容,如图2所示。要求程序中不得使用任何变量。
private sub command1_click()
me.caption = text1.text & text2.text
end sub
1-9:在名称为Form1的窗体上画一个标签(名称为Label1,标题为“输入信息”)、一个文本框(名称为Text1,Text属性为空白)和一个命令按钮(名称为Command1,标题为“显示”),如图1所示。然后编写命令按钮的Click事件过程。程序运行后,在文本框中输入“计算机等级考试”,然后单击命令按钮,则标签和文本框消失,并在窗体上显示文本框中的内容。运行后的窗体如图2所示。要求程序中不得使用任何变量。
private sub command1_click()
print text1.text
label1.visible = false
text1.visible = false
end sub
1-10:在名称为Form1的窗体上画一个名称为L1的标签,标题为“口令”;画两个文本框,名称分别为Text1、Text2,都没有
初始内容;再画三个命令按钮,名称分别为C1、C2、C3,标题分别为“显示口令”、“隐藏口令”、“复制口令”。在开始运行时,向Text1中输入的所有字符,都显示“*”,单击“显示口令”按钮后,在Text1中显示所有字符,再单击“以隐藏口令”后,Text1中的字符不变,但显示的都是“?”,单击“复制口令”后,把Text1中的实际内容复制到Text2中,如图所示。
要求:
1) 在属性窗口中,把窗体的标题改为“口令窗口”;
2) 建立适当的事件过程,完成上述功能。每个过程中只允许写一条语句,且不能使用变量。
1)点击窗体,设置窗体的Caption为口令窗口,设置text1的passwordchar属性为*
2)
private sub c1_click()
text1.passwordchar=""
end sub
private sub c2_click()
text1.passwordchar="?"
end sub
private sub c3_click()
text2.text = text1.text
end sub
private sub cmd1_click()
cmd2.move cmd1.left,cmd1.top,cmd1.width,cmd1.height
end sub
1-5:在名称为Form1的窗体上画一个命令按钮,名称为Command1,其标题为“移动本按钮”,如图所示。要求编写适当的事件过程,使得程序运行是,每单击按钮一次,按钮向左移动100。要求:程序中不得使用变量,事件过程中只能写一条语句。
private sub command1_click()
command1.left = command1.left - 100
end sub
在名称为Form1的窗体上画一个名称为L1的标签,标题为“请确认”;再画两个命令按钮,名称分别为C1、C2,标题分别为“是”、“否”,高均为300,宽均为800。如图所示。
请在属性窗口中设置适当属性满足以下要求:
1) 窗体标题为“确认”,窗体标题栏上不显示最大化和最小化按钮;
2) 在任何情况下,按回车键都相当于单击“是”按钮;按ESC键都相当于单击“否”按钮。
1)点击窗体,属性里面设置Caption为确认,设置MaxButton=False,MinButton=False
2)点击“是”按钮(c1),设置Default=true
点击“否”按钮(c2),设置cancel=true
1-7:在名称为Form1的窗体上画一个名称为Lab的标签,设置高度为450,宽度为1500,标签上显示内容为“标签”。要求程序运行后,若双击窗体则执行语句Lab.Caption=“双击”,若单击窗体则执行语句Lab.Caption=“”。
private sub form_click()
lab.caption = ""
end sub
private sub form_dblclick()
lab.caption = "双击"
end sub
1-8:在名称为Form1的窗体上画两个标签(名称分别为Label1和Label2,标题分别为“书名”和“作者”)、两个文本框(名称分别为Text1和Text2,Text属性均为空白)和一个命令按钮(名称为Command1,标题为“显示”),如图1所示。然后编写命令按钮的Click事件过程。程序运行后,在两个文本框中分别输入书名和作者,然后单击命令按钮,则在窗体的标题栏上先后显示两个文本框中的内容,如图2所示。要求程序中不得使用任何变量。
private sub command1_click()
me.caption = text1.text & text2.text
end sub
1-9:在名称为Form1的窗体上画一个标签(名称为Label1,标题为“输入信息”)、一个文本框(名称为Text1,Text属性为空白)和一个命令按钮(名称为Command1,标题为“显示”),如图1所示。然后编写命令按钮的Click事件过程。程序运行后,在文本框中输入“计算机等级考试”,然后单击命令按钮,则标签和文本框消失,并在窗体上显示文本框中的内容。运行后的窗体如图2所示。要求程序中不得使用任何变量。
private sub command1_click()
print text1.text
label1.visible = false
text1.visible = false
end sub
1-10:在名称为Form1的窗体上画一个名称为L1的标签,标题为“口令”;画两个文本框,名称分别为Text1、Text2,都没有
初始内容;再画三个命令按钮,名称分别为C1、C2、C3,标题分别为“显示口令”、“隐藏口令”、“复制口令”。在开始运行时,向Text1中输入的所有字符,都显示“*”,单击“显示口令”按钮后,在Text1中显示所有字符,再单击“以隐藏口令”后,Text1中的字符不变,但显示的都是“?”,单击“复制口令”后,把Text1中的实际内容复制到Text2中,如图所示。
要求:
1) 在属性窗口中,把窗体的标题改为“口令窗口”;
2) 建立适当的事件过程,完成上述功能。每个过程中只允许写一条语句,且不能使用变量。
1)点击窗体,设置窗体的Caption为口令窗口,设置text1的passwordchar属性为*
2)
private sub c1_click()
text1.passwordchar=""
end sub
private sub c2_click()
text1.passwordchar="?"
end sub
private sub c3_click()
text2.text = text1.text
end sub
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询